Fig. 7

nEXOs HMGB3 regulates metastasis via angiogenesis.

AThe HMGB3 levels of CNE2-NC-exo and CNE2-shHMGB3-exo were measured by western blot. B Flow cytometry analysis showed the percentage of gDNA and HMGB3 expression in exosomes of CNE2 cell supernatant. C The CCK8 assays were performed to measure proliferation of HUVECs treated with the two exosomes. D The tube formation assays were performed to measure tube forming ability of HUVECs treated with various exosomes. The scale bar represents 200 μm. E Gross-observation exosomes modulated angiogenesis. F Frozen slices of the Matrigel plugs were stained with eosin-hematoxylin. The scale bar in 200× images represents 100 µm. The scale bar in 400× images represents 50 µm. G The GFP‐positive (green) intersegmental vessel (ISV) and CNE2 cells (red) are photographed by a microscope for 30 embryos per group. The red box was further photographed with a confocal microscope. The red arrow indicates a vascular defect. White arrows indicate metastasis nodes. H Percentage of vascular formation of ten embryos per group. I Quantification of migratory cell numbers. All experiments were conducted with three independent replicates. Mean ± SD, **P < 0.05, **P < 0.01, ***P < 0.001, student’s test.
